Automotive Plastics Market Is Anticipated To Expand From $79.5 Billion In 2024 To $149.2 Billion By 2034
The Automotive Plastics Market is projected to witness significant growth, expanding from $79.5 billion in 2024 to $149.2 billion by 2034, at a compound annual growth rate (CAGR) of approximately 6.5%. This growth is attributed to the ongoing shift towards lightweight materials, fuel efficiency, and sustainability within the automotive industry. Plastics play a pivotal role in the modern vehicle manufacturing process, offering substantial benefits such as weight reduction, improved performance, and cost-effective solutions. The market includes a wide range of polymers, including polypropylene, polyurethane, and polyvinyl chloride, which are used in various automotive components like dashboards, bumpers, door panels, and interior trim.
The demand for automotive plastics is driven by the increasing need for vehicle manufacturers to meet stricter fuel efficiency and emission standards. By using lightweight materials like plastics, automakers can reduce the overall weight of vehicles, thereby improving fuel efficiency and reducing carbon emissions. Furthermore, plastics offer enhanced design flexibility, allowing manufacturers to experiment with new forms and structures while ensuring durability and safety. These advantages are fueling the expansion of the automotive plastics market as manufacturers look for innovative solutions to meet evolving consumer demands and regulatory requirements.

Automotive Plastics Market Dynamics
Several factors are contributing to the growth of the automotive plastics market. One of the primary drivers is the automotive industry’s ongoing focus on sustainability and reducing the environmental impact of vehicle production. Plastics, particularly those used in lightweighting, help automakers reduce the overall weight of vehicles, which directly contributes to improved fuel efficiency and lower carbon emissions. This has become a significant factor as automakers seek to meet stringent emission regulations and consumer expectations for greener transportation options.
The growing popularity of electric vehicles (EVs) is also driving the demand for automotive plastics. EVs typically require lighter materials to offset the weight of the battery packs and improve overall efficiency. As a result, manufacturers are increasingly turning to plastics for applications like battery enclosures, exterior panels, and interior components to achieve weight reduction and enhance performance.
Moreover, the versatility of automotive plastics makes them a go-to choice for a wide range of applications, from exterior body parts to interior trim. The ability to mold plastics into complex shapes and designs allows for greater flexibility in vehicle design, enabling manufacturers to create aesthetically appealing and functionally efficient vehicles. Additionally, advancements in plastic processing technologies are enabling the production of more durable and high-performance materials, further driving their adoption in the automotive sector.

Regional Analysis
The automotive plastics market is experiencing varied growth across different regions, driven by factors such as automotive production volume, economic conditions, and regulatory pressures. North America and Europe are among the leading regions in terms of market share due to the presence of established automotive manufacturing hubs and stringent regulatory standards aimed at reducing vehicle emissions.
In North America, particularly in the United States, the demand for automotive plastics is being driven by the automotive industry’s shift towards lighter materials, with a focus on improving fuel efficiency. The region is also witnessing growth in electric vehicle production, which further fuels the need for lightweight materials like plastics.
Europe is another key market for automotive plastics, with major automotive manufacturers in countries like Germany, France, and the United Kingdom adopting plastics in vehicle production to meet the EU’s stringent environmental regulations. The growing emphasis on sustainability and carbon reduction is expected to continue to drive the demand for automotive plastics in the region.
In Asia-Pacific, especially in China and India, the automotive plastics market is experiencing rapid growth. The increasing production of vehicles, coupled with a rising middle-class population and demand for personal vehicles, is creating a favorable environment for the market. Additionally, the growing adoption of electric vehicles in these regions is further boosting the demand for lightweight materials.
Recent News & Developments
Recent developments in the automotive plastics market have focused on innovation, sustainability, and the integration of new technologies. One notable trend is the increasing use of recycled plastics in automotive applications, as companies strive to meet environmental goals. For instance, major players like BASF and Covestro have introduced new materials that are designed to be more sustainable and environmentally friendly, with a focus on recyclability and reducing the carbon footprint of automotive production.
Moreover, the rise of electric vehicles has sparked innovation in the types of plastics used in automotive manufacturing. New plastic materials that are more heat-resistant and lightweight are being developed to meet the unique needs of EVs, particularly in components like battery enclosures and exterior panels.
